As of early August 2025, Vietnam’s automotive market has witnessed a wave of significant incentives in the small 7-seat MPV segment, with discounts of up to tens of millions of VND to stimulate purchasing demand.
Mitsubishi Xpander
Specifically, customers purchasing the Mitsubishi Xpander 2025 model in August will receive support for 50% of the registration fee (equivalent to a cash incentive of 30 – 35 million VND, depending on the version). Moreover, customers will also receive a series of genuine gifts such as: Fuel vouchers (worth 15 – 20 million VND), 360-degree camera system (worth 20 million VND) or 1-year physical insurance (worth 09 million VND).
Exclusively for customers buying the Mitsubishi Xpander 2024 MT version, there is a support of 50% registration fee (equivalent to a cash incentive of 28 million VND) and a gift of 1 fuel voucher (worth 15 million VND) and 1 reverse camera (worth 2.5 million VND).
Toyota Veloz Cross and Avanza Premio
The Toyota Veloz Cross and Avanza Premio also offer a 100% registration fee support in August, equivalent to a cash incentive of 56 – 60 million VND for the Avanza Premio and 64 – 66 million VND for the Veloz Cross. After the incentive, the Avanza Premio’s price ranges from 502 – 538 million VND. The Veloz Cross’s price ranges from 574 – 594 million VND. When including gifts, the total value of incentives can be up to 69 – 75 million VND.
Suzuki XL7
At dealerships, the Suzuki XL7 hybrid is being offered with incentives of up to 75 million VND, including 100% registration fee support and a genuine accessory package. The price of the car after incentives ranges from 524 – 532 million VND, depending on the dealership.
Hyundai Stargazer
This August, Hyundai Stargazer is supported by the company with 50% registration fee, equivalent to 24.5 – 30 million VND, depending on the version.
Some dealerships offer additional incentives to stimulate sales, bringing the maximum incentive to up to 40 million VND. After the promotion, the price of the Stargazer ranges from 450 – 550 million VND.
Kia Carens
Not to be outdone, the Kia Carens also offers a 50% registration fee support, equivalent to 30 – 35 million VND depending on the version. The actual selling price of the car after the incentive ranges from 554 – 744 million VND.
The small 7-seat MPV segment is one of the best-selling segments in Vietnam. In 2024, the segment’s sales volume reached about 50,000 units, accounting for 10% of the automobile market share. Among them, Mitsubishi Xpander took the lead with nearly 20,000 units, ranking in the top 3 in the entire market. In the first half of 2025, this segment consumed nearly 17,000 units, accounting for 6% market share; Xpander alone accounted for more than 8,000 units, equivalent to 50% of the segment’s sales.
MPVs score points for their spacious interior, fuel-efficient engines, and reasonable prices. About 50% of annual sales come from transportation business needs. However, the high level of competition forces car companies to continuously offer promotions to maintain market share.
